Calories in Milk, whole, 3.25% milkfat, with added vitamin D

There are 61 calories in 100 g of milk, whole, 3.25% milkfat, with added vitamin d — about 17kcal per ounce. Below is the calorie breakdown by portion, plus the macro split. Want the full vitamin & mineral profile? See milk, whole, 3.25% milkfat, with added vitamin d nutrition facts →

Macro split per 100 g: 3.1 g protein · 4.8 g carbs · 3.3 g fat.

All amounts are shown per 100 g of milk, whole, 3.25% milkfat, with added vitamin d (SR Legacy), the standard basis USDA uses so foods can be compared like-for-like. Scale by the weight of your portion to get the nutrition for the amount you actually eat.

Data source: USDA FoodData Central #171265
